Reggie Bush to throw out first pitch on Friday

May 15th, 2024

LOS ANGELES – Former NFL and University of Southern California running back Reggie Bush is slated to throw out the ceremonial first pitch ahead of the Los Angeles Dodgers game against the Cincinnati Reds on Friday, May 17 at 7:10 p.m.

On April 24, the Heisman Trust announced that it would return Bush’s 2005 Heisman Trophy, citing "enormous changes in the college football landscape” after he was required to forfeit it in 2010.

In his junior year at USC in 2005, Bush amassed 16 rushing touchdowns on 1,740 yards in 13 games and 37 receptions for 478 yards. He was drafted by the New Orleans Saints with the second overall pick in the 2006 NFL Draft. He played a total of 11 seasons in the NFL, amassing 5,490 yards rushing with 36 touchdowns, as well as 3,598 yards receiving with 18 touchdowns. Bush was a part of the New Orleans Saints Super Bowl XLIV Champions, as well as a First-Team All-Pro selection in 2008.
